*{margin:0;padding:0;box-sizing:border-box}:root{--bg-primary: #1a1a1a;--bg-secondary: #252525;--bg-tertiary: #2a2a2a;--border-color: #3a3a3a;--text-primary: #e0e0e0;--text-secondary: #aaa;--text-tertiary: #888;--accent-blue: #4a90e2;--accent-blue-hover: #357abd;--accent-blue-light: #6ab0f5;--accent-green: #6f6;--accent-red: #f66;--gradient-primary: linear-gradient(135deg, #357abd 0%, #4a90e2 50%, #6ab0f5 100%);--gradient-hero: linear-gradient(180deg, rgba(74, 144, 226, .1) 0%, rgba(74, 144, 226, .05) 100%)}html{scroll-behavior:smooth}body{font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,sans-serif;background:var(--bg-primary);color:var(--text-primary);line-height:1.6;overflow-x:hidden;position:relative}body:before{content:"";position:fixed;top:0;left:0;right:0;bottom:0;background-image:radial-gradient(circle,#333 1px,transparent 1px);background-size:30px 30px;pointer-events:none;z-index:0;opacity:1}.container{max-width:1200px;margin:0 auto;padding:0 24px;position:relative;z-index:1}section{position:relative;z-index:1}.nav{position:fixed;top:0;left:0;right:0;background:#1a1a1af2;-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);z-index:10000;transition:all .3s ease;box-shadow:0 2px 8px #0000004d}.nav-content{display:flex;justify-content:space-between;align-items:center;height:70px}.nav-left{display:flex;align-items:center;gap:12px}.logo{width:32px;height:32px}.brand{font-size:24px;font-weight:600;color:#fff}.nav-right{display:flex;align-items:center;gap:32px}.nav-link{color:var(--text-secondary);text-decoration:none;font-weight:500;font-size:15px;transition:color .3s ease}.nav-link:hover{color:var(--text-primary)}.nav-icon-link{display:flex;align-items:center;color:var(--text-secondary);text-decoration:none;transition:color .3s ease,transform .2s ease}.nav-icon-link:hover{color:var(--text-primary);transform:scale(1.1)}.btn-primary{display:inline-block;padding:5px 12px;background:var(--accent-blue);color:#fff;text-decoration:none;border-radius:8px;font-weight:600;font-size:15px;transition:all .3s ease;border:none;cursor:pointer}.btn-primary:hover{background:var(--accent-blue-hover);box-shadow:0 4px 12px #4a90e280}.btn-secondary{display:inline-block;padding:10px 24px;background:transparent;color:var(--text-primary);text-decoration:none;border-radius:8px;font-weight:600;font-size:15px;border:2px solid var(--border-color);transition:all .3s ease;cursor:pointer}.btn-secondary:hover{border-color:var(--accent-blue);background:#4a90e21a}.btn-large{padding:14px 32px;font-size:16px}.hero{padding:160px 0 100px;position:relative;overflow:hidden}.hero-content{max-width:900px;margin:0 auto;text-align:center;position:relative;z-index:1}.hero-title{font-size:64px;font-weight:700;line-height:1.1;margin-bottom:24px;color:#fff;letter-spacing:-.02em}.gradient-text{background:var(--gradient-primary);-webkit-background-clip:text;-webkit-text-fill-color:transparent;background-clip:text}.hero-description{font-size:20px;color:var(--text-secondary);margin-bottom:40px;line-height:1.6;max-width:700px;margin-left:auto;margin-right:auto}.hero-cta{display:flex;gap:16px;justify-content:center;flex-wrap:wrap}.demo-section{padding:60px 0;position:relative}.demo-image{width:100%;height:auto;display:block;border-radius:12px;border:1px solid var(--border-color);box-shadow:0 20px 60px #00000080;transition:transform .3s ease}.demo-image:hover{transform:translateY(-4px)}.features{padding:90px 0}.section-title{font-size:48px;font-weight:700;text-align:center;margin-bottom:64px;color:#fff;letter-spacing:-.02em}.section-subtitle{font-size:18px;color:var(--text-secondary);text-align:center;margin-top:-48px;margin-bottom:64px}.features-gr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(320px,1fr));gap:32px}.feature-card{background:var(--bg-secondary);border:1px solid var(--border-color);border-radius:12px;padding:32px;transition:all .3s ease;opacity:0;transform:translateY(30px)}.feature-card:hover{transform:translateY(-4px)}.feature-icon{width:48px;height:48px;background:#4a90e21a;border-radius:12px;display:flex;align-items:center;justify-content:center;color:var(--accent-blue);margin-bottom:20px}.feature-card h3{font-size:22px;font-weight:600;margin-bottom:12px;color:#fff}.feature-card p{color:var(--text-secondary);line-height:1.6;font-size:15px}.integrations{padding:90px 0}.integrations-gr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(280px,1fr));gap:32px;margin-top:48px}.integration-item{background:var(--bg-secondary);border:1px solid var(--border-color);border-radius:12px;padding:40px 32px;text-align:center;transition:all .3s ease;opacity:0;transform:translateY(30px)}.integration-item:hover{border-color:var(--accent-blue);transform:translateY(-4px);box-shadow:0 8px 24px #4a90e233}.integration-logo{font-size:28px;font-weight:700;margin-bottom:12px;background:var(--gradient-primary);-webkit-background-clip:text;-webkit-text-fill-color:transparent;background-clip:text}.integration-item p{color:var(--text-secondary);font-size:14px}.use-cases{padding:90px 0}.use-cases-gr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(280px,1fr));gap:48px;margin-top:64px}.use-case{position:relative;padding-left:24px;opacity:0;transform:translateY(30px)}.use-case:before{content:"";position:absolute;left:0;top:0;bottom:0;width:3px;background:var(--gradient-primary);border-radius:2px}.use-case-number{font-size:14px;font-weight:700;color:var(--accent-blue);margin-bottom:12px;letter-spacing:.1em}.use-case h3{font-size:24px;font-weight:600;margin-bottom:12px;color:#fff}.use-case p{color:var(--text-secondary);line-height:1.6;font-size:15px}.footer{padding:80px 0 40px}.footer-content{display:grid;grid-template-columns:1fr 1fr;gap:64px;margin-bottom:48px}.footer-brand{display:flex;align-items:center;gap:12px;margin-bottom:16px}.footer-logo{width:32px;height:32px}.footer-brand span{font-size:24px;font-weight:600;color:#fff}.footer-description{color:var(--text-secondary);font-size:15px}.footer-links{display:grid;grid-template-columns:repeat(2,1fr);gap:48px}.footer-column h4{font-size:14px;font-weight:600;color:#fff;margin-bottom:16px;text-transform:uppercase;letter-spacing:.05em}.footer-column a{display:block;color:var(--text-secondary);text-decoration:none;font-size:15px;margin-bottom:12px;transition:color .3s ease}.footer-column a:hover{color:var(--accent-blue)}.footer-bottom{text-align:center;padding-top:32px;border-top:1px solid var(--border-color)}.footer-bottom p{color:var(--text-tertiary);font-size:14px}@keyframes fadeInUp{0%{opacity:0;transform:translateY(30px)}to{opacity:1;transform:translateY(0)}}.fade-in-up{animation:fadeInUp .6s ease-out forwards}@keyframes slideLeft{0%{transform:translate(0)}to{transform:translate(-100%)}}@media(max-width:768px){.nav-content{height:60px}.nav-right{gap:16px}.nav-link{display:none}.nav-link:last-child{display:inline-block}.hero{padding:120px 0 60px}.hero-title{font-size:40px}.hero-description{font-size:18px}.section-title{font-size:36px;margin-bottom:48px}.features-grid{grid-template-columns:1fr}.use-cases-grid{grid-template-columns:1fr;gap:32px}.footer-content{grid-template-columns:1fr;gap:48px}.footer-links{grid-template-columns:1fr;gap:32px}.cta-content h2{font-size:36px}.cta-content p{font-size:16px}}@media(max-width:480px){.hero-title{font-size:32px}.hero-description{font-size:16px}.btn-large{padding:12px 24px;font-size:15px}.section-title,.cta-content h2{font-size:28px}}::-webkit-scrollbar{width:8px;height:8px}::-webkit-scrollbar-track{background:var(--bg-primary)}::-webkit-scrollbar-thumb{background:var(--border-color);border-radius:4px}::-webkit-scrollbar-thumb:hover{background:#4a4a4a}
